Vue Vite_快速高效构建传统的构建工具启动慢关注社区动态和更新获取最新工具特性和最佳实践
Vue Vite:快速开发,高效构建
Vue Vite 是一款专门为 Vue.js 应用程序设计的现代化前端构建工具和开发服务器。它不仅能让你开发起来飞快,还能让最终的应用构建得又快又高效。
一、极速冷启动
传统的构建工具启动慢,Vue Vite 可不一样。它通过预构建依赖和按需加载模块,让开发服务器几乎是瞬间启动的,速度飞快!
二、即时热模块替换(HMR)
热模块替换就是边改边看效果,不用刷新页面。Vue Vite 的 HMR 功能让你修改代码后,立刻看到变化,开发效率飙升!
| 优势 | 详细说明 |
|---|---|
| 提高开发效率 | 实时看到修改效果,减少等待时间。 |
| 保持应用状态 | 避免重新加载页面导致的状态丢失。 |
三、优化的生产构建
Vue Vite 不仅开发快,生产构建也优化得很好。它使用 Rollup 进行打包,生成的生产代码高效且体积小,确保应用在生产环境中的性能和加载速度。
| 优化方面 | 详细说明 |
|---|---|
| 代码分割 | 按需加载模块,减少初始加载时间。 |
| Tree-shaking | 移除未使用的代码,减少包体积。 |
| 现代浏览器支持 | 利用现代浏览器特性,提升性能。 |
四、支持现代浏览器特性
Vue Vite 是为现代浏览器打造的,它利用了 ES6 模块、原生 ESM 支持等新特性,不仅简化了开发流程,还提升了构建速度和性能。
| 支持特性 | 详细说明 |
|---|---|
| 原生 ESM 支持 | 利用浏览器原生支持的 ES6 模块,减少构建步骤。 |
| 动态导入 | 按需加载模块,提高性能。 |
| CSS 模块化 | 支持 CSS 模块化,避免样式冲突。 |
五、直观的配置和插件系统
Vue Vite 的配置文件简洁直观,上手快。还有强大的插件系统,可以轻松扩展功能,比如 Babel 转译和 TypeScript 支持。
| 优点 | 详细说明 |
|---|---|
| 简洁易用 | 配置文件简洁直观,易于理解和使用。 |
| 灵活扩展 | 插件系统强大,支持多种功能扩展。 |
| 社区支持 | 活跃的社区和丰富的插件资源,帮助开发者快速解决问题。 |
六、Vue Vite 的应用实例
Vue Vite 在很多实际项目中都有应用,比如大型的电商网站和实时数据分析平台。它帮助开发者更快地迭代新功能,提升用户体验。
Vue Vite 是一个强大的工具,它能让你的 Vue.js 开发更快更高效。通过学习配置和插件系统,结合其他前端工具,你可以打造出更加复杂和高效的应用程序。
- 深度学习 Vue Vite 的配置和插件系统。
- 结合其他前端工具,构建复杂高效的应用。
- 关注社区动态和更新,获取最新工具特性和最佳实践。
相关问答FAQs
以下是一些关于 Vue Vite 的常见问题解答:
Vue Vite 是什么?
Vue Vite 是一个基于 Vue.js 的轻量级构建工具,专为快速开发和原型设计。
Vite 与 Vue CLI 有何不同?
Vite 是轻量级的,Vue CLI 则是全功能的。Vite 更适合小型项目和原型开发,Vue CLI 更适合大型项目。
Vite 的优势有哪些?
Vite 优势包括快速冷启动、实时编译、按需加载、TypeScript 支持和灵活的插件系统。